Opinion

Bloodworth, J.

The record in this case does not show that the court erred either in striking the plea of the defendants or in thereafter directing a verdict for the plaintiff.

Judgment affirmed.

Broyles, O. J., and Luke, J., concur. B. E. Manry, A. M. Zellner, for plaintiffs in error. James M. Smith, contra.
